The Tavush for the Homeland movement, led by Archbishop Bagrat Galstanyan, has gathered in front of the Armenian government main building for the upcoming Cabinet session with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an. Archbishop Galstanyan aims to engage with the political spectrum of Armenia to outline their route and program of action. Supporters have joined the movement to oppose the current government’s policy of unilateral concessions to Azerbaijan, with civil disobedience actions taking place in Yerevan.

With a strong presence at the government building, Archbishop Galstanyan and his followers are determined to make their voices heard and push for change. They are gearing up for meetings with various political figures in the coming days to discuss specific actions to be taken. The movement is poised to bring attention to their cause and advocate for a stronger stance against concessions to Azerbaijan.
